Output 3f56fb17c8a0b8892a81b2a9a4689a39091e96c49b1f2b3de19fcbd10b0aec0f:1

value
162801162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ad6ef9084dd8abbc09c6d9097aa29d474089c980 OP_EQUAL
address
MPiC598XaEf88EWecsWKjQSUwNzbdB63ux
transaction
3f56fb17c8a0b8892a81b2a9a4689a39091e96c49b1f2b3de19fcbd10b0aec0f
spent
true